Oglethorpe County's game last Tuesday was a loss, but they didn't let that memory haunt them on Friday. Everything went their way against the Washington-Wilkes Tigers as the Oglethorpe County Patriots made off with a 7-1 victory. Miguel Rios was a massive factor in the win as he booted in three goals all by himself.
The win got Oglethorpe County back to even at 1-1. As for Washington-Wilkes, they are on a three-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 1-3.
Both teams are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Oglethorpe County will welcome Jefferson County at 7:00 p.m. on Tuesday. Jefferson County is strutting in with some offensive muscle as they've averaged 4 goals per game this season. As for Washington-Wilkes, they will be playing at home against Elbert County at 7:30 p.m. on Tuesday.
